If your cast net gets caught up on some rocks or other submerged debris, and you end up shredding it beyond repair, all is not lost. Salvage the weights on the bottom. They usually weigh about 1 ounce and work just as an egg weight on an in-line catfish or striper rig.
I recently did this exact thing, I had 4 old nets sitting around and I just salvaged all of the weights. They are great to use when river fishing for big cats, I get snagged and lots of weights are lost so this is a great way to save a little money.
